During a Singapore Trip a traveler will have the opportunity to visit the following important spots:
•City district, covering St. Andrew Cathedral, City Hall and Court, Victoria theatre and Concert Hall, Raffles Statue, Raffles Landing Site
•Museum district, covering Canning Hill and Battle Box
•Sentosa, covering Universal Studios, Festive walks and Light and Sound Shows
•Marina Bay covering Suntec City, Fountain of Wealth, Esplanade, Waterboat house, Merlion Park, Singapore flyer and River Cruise
•China Town, Campong Glam, and Little India, which are important shopping centres
•Botanic Garden, Orchard Road and Singapore Zoo

For those travelers who want to make their own Singapore holidays, there are plenty of flight connections available from every city in India.
About 11 flight connections operate from New Delhi to Singapore, most of the days 5 of them direct flights between these two destinations and in a week, there are 126 flights flying.
Likewise, there are about 25 flight connections operating from Mumbai to Singapore, most of the days 7 of them non-stop flights between these two destinations and in a week, there are 99 schedules between these two cities.
About 22 flight connections are operating from Bangalore to Singapore, 2 of them non-stop flights between these two destinations and in a week, there are 88 schedules.
For those from Kolkata to make their own Singapore holidays there are about 22 flight connections to Singapore, 2 of them non-stop flights between these two destinations and In a week, 53 schedules.
There are about 11 flight connections for Singapore travel from Chennai , 5 of them non-stop flights between these two destinations and in a week, there are 84 schedules of Chennai to Singapore flights.
